What is the WisNode Tag?
The WisNode Tag is a compact GPS tracker for LoRaWAN designed for personal safety, asset tracking, outdoor activities, and industrial monitoring. It combines GNSS positioning, motion detection, Bluetooth configuration, and long-range LoRaWAN connectivity in a slim rechargeable device that can be carried, worn, or attached to equipment.
Using the TrackIT® mobile application, users can configure it over Bluetooth and deploy it as a tracking device. It can be used in location tracking, geofencing, and event monitoring. The device supports both the TrackIT ecosystem and third-party platforms such as ChirpStack and The Things Stack. It is compatible with a WisGate gateway for LoRaWAN and can be deployed as part of a complete tracking solution for personnel monitoring, asset tracking, geofencing, and SOS alert applications.

How a Tracking Deployment for LoRaWAN Works
The WisNode Tag operates as part of a complete tracking solution for LoRaWAN. Location, motion, and event data are collected by the tracker and delivered through LoRaWAN infrastructure to the selected monitoring platform.
|
Component |
Function |
|
WisNode Tag |
Collects location and motion information |
|
Gateway for LoRaWAN |
Receives tracker messages |
|
Network Server |
Processes traffic on LoRaWAN |
|
Application Platform |
Displays locations, alerts, and events |
|
User |
Monitors personnel and assets |
Key Features of the WisNode Tag
- Compact and lightweight design (92x59x7.55 mm / 50g)
- GPS tracker for LoRaWAN with TrackIT firmware
- Bluetooth configuration using the TrackIT mobile application
- Nordic nRF52840 ultra-low-power MCU
- Semtech SX1262 LoRa transceiver
- Integrated GNSS positioning module
- Built-in accelerometer for motion detection
- SOS alert functionality
- Internal LoRa, BLE, and GNSS antennas
- Rechargeable 1000 mAh lithium battery
- Magnetic USB charging interface
- Compatible with WisGate gateways and third-party LoRaWAN networks
Geofencing and Event Monitoring
The WisNode Tag can function as a geofencing tracker for LoRaWAN by generating events when tracked personnel or assets enter or leave predefined areas. Geofencing can be used to improve worker safety, monitor equipment utilization, verify site access, and detect unexpected asset movement.
Common geofencing applications include:
- Lone worker safety monitoring
- Construction equipment tracking
- Facility access control
- Asset movement auditing
- Campus and site boundary monitoring

Use Case Examples for the WisNode Tag
Organizations use monitoring solutions to improve visibility of personnel and assets while reducing manual tracking efforts across large operational areas.
Use Case #1: Lone Worker GPS Tracker
A utility contractor experienced delayed worker check-ins during remote inspections. After deploying the WisNode Tag with SOS alerts and GNSS tracking, response verification improved from 78% to 97% across 50 field shifts. Results were validated through scheduled location reporting. Production deployment achieved consistent performance across 40 units. The customer reported that worker visibility became much easier to manage.
Use Case #2: Construction Equipment Tracking
Meanwhile, a construction company struggled to locate shared equipment between work zones. Using an equipment tracking device and motion monitoring, search times dropped from 18 minutes to 4 minutes on average. Testing covered 30 days and 25 tracked assets. Deployment records showed repeatable results across all devices. The customer stated that equipment utilization improved because locations were always available.
